FLEA PROBLEM IN CALIFORNIA

C. J. LUNSFORD, M.D.

Arch Derm Syphilol. 1949;60(6):1184-1202.

Since this article does not have an abstract, we have provided the first 150 words of the full text PDF and any section headings.

THE TESTIMONY of present day dermatologists is that fleas are more of a nuisance in California, particularly in the San Francisco Bay area, than elsewhere in the United States.

HISTORICAL ACCOUNTS

In the vast literature relating to exploration, settlement and life in California the references to misery caused by fleas encountered by the authors are related entirely to experiences in Northern California.

Padre Juan Crespi,1 the diarist of the Portola expedition of 1769, wrote that when the expedition visited an Indian village on Purisima Creek in San Mateo County they found the grass huts so infested with fleas that they called it "Village of the Fleas."
